We require the PP to pull this summer freezer regeneration project Portman (25/07/2016)

We registered a motion in the Regional Assembly for the central government is urged to resolve once and for all and, agile, transparent and participatory project for the regeneration of Portman Bay, with the endowment would budget accordingly and without further "obstacles".

The regional deputy of Podemos, Andrés Pedroza, lamented the fact that the latest information we have about the future regeneration of Portman Bay, and how it is working in different ministries, Finance and Environment "the have obtained by the press and at any time by representatives of the regional government, they must exercise partners between citizens and the central government "

Thus, denounced Pedreño, "we learned that the project could be frozen" if the entry into force of the Order of the Ministry of Finance of July 20 on non-priority expenditures in the General State Administration, the budget for the works regeneration of Portman Bay are on stand by, in this case that this project may incur a non-priority spending between the Ministries of Finance and Environment, which then may arise debts for the Administration ".

Given this scenario, the regional deputy of Podemos, has urged the Regional government and specifically the Minister of Public Works, Pedro Fernandez Barrachina to "clarify the real situation in which the regeneration project of Portman Bay is located, and exercise its public representative and the interests of Murcia so that you should report transparently to the public of what will be the future of the project, and what will make the regional government to prevent the regeneration project Bay Portman succeed.

In this sense, Pedreño reported that the Parliamentary Group we registered a motion in the Regional Assembly for the Regional Assembly urge the central government to "have adequate funds in the State Budget 2016, to be reach 6 million originally planned, to undertake the project of regeneration of Portman Bay and thus it ends with the awarding process of regeneration works and is contracted to the company that carried out without further delay ".

the Government of Spain is also urged to resume and complete the works adequacy of the short San Jose as a precondition for the continuity of the ill-fated project to regenerate Portman Bay condition.
